Schlafly Oatmeal Stout

Schlafly Beer
Tap to rate
🌍 United States · Oatmeal Stout · One of 18 Oatmeal Stouts in hopIQ

A classic British-style stout with oat flakes in the mash for a smooth, creamy body. Dark and roasty with chocolate and coffee notes, balanced by just enough bitterness and a nutty character from the roasted barley. One of Schlafly's most consistent year-round performers.

Tasting Notes

AI-generated sensory profile for Schlafly Oatmeal Stout

Appearance

Deep mahogany to near-black in the glass, with opaque density throughout. A firm, tan head builds readily and clings to the glass with lasting Schaumkleiden. Carbonation is restrained but present, lending a soft visual texture.

deep mahoganyopaquepersistent head

Aroma

The nose opens with pronounced roasted barley and dark chocolate, underscored by gentle coffee notes. Oat flakes contribute a subtle grain sweetness that softens the roasted character. No hop aroma intrudes; the bouquet remains malt-forward and inviting.

roasted barleydark chocolatecoffeegrain sweetness

Taste

Entry is smooth and creamy across the palate, the oatmeal adjunct evident in the rounded mouthfeel. Chocolate and nutty roast develop in the mid-palate, layered with restrained bitterness that never dominates. The 30 IBU sits in balance, allowing roast and sweetness to coexist without harsh edges.

creamy mouthfeelchocolate, nut roastbalanced bitterness

Finish

The finish is clean and moderately lingering, trailing roasted grain and subtle cocoa into the aftertaste. Drying occurs gently without astringency.

About Oatmeal Stout

Style guide · what to expect · how to find alternatives

What is a Oatmeal Stout?

Stouts are dark ales with roasted barley character, 4–8% ABV and IBU 25–45. Expect coffee, dark chocolate and toast flavors with a creamy body and dry finish.
